Replacing your windows involves a few moving parts that shift the total. The biggest factor is the frame material—vinyl is usually the most budget-friendly, while wood or fiberglass typically runs higher. You’ll also see price changes based on the type of glass, like double or triple panes, and any specialized coatings for energy efficiency. The number of windows, the complexity of the installation, and whether you need custom sizing will also play a role in your final quote. Exact pricing confirmed free on the call.

Window replacement services in New Bedford typically include the removal of old windows. Professionals then install the new units securely. This ensures a proper seal to prevent drafts and water damage. The service often covers the disposal of old windows. It also includes sealing and finishing around the new frames. Some services might offer additional treatments like window cleaning post-installation.
